Pope St. John XXIII remains one of the most beloved modern popes because he combined pastoral warmth with real courage. His short pontificate helped prepare the Church for Vatican II, but his deeper legacy is spiritual: trust in Providence, charity in speech, and confidence that the Church can face the future without fear.
